What Cause High Levels Of HG Of 400 After Miscarriage?
hi, i had a miscarriage 2 weeks ago and have been for 3 blood tests since then to check my HG levels. Since those 2 weeks it has only dropped from 475 to 400. The hospital has asked me to go back next week for another blood test. Why is my HG levels not going down
Hi, Thanks for asking. Based on your clinical history and query, my opinion is as follows: 1. It takes 4-6 weeks for HCG level to return to normal. 2. HCG has a higher half life and it would take time to reduce. Not to worry as it reducing. 3. If it is further increasing, molar pregnancy might need to be evaluated. However, as it is reducing, you need not worry about it for now. Hope it helps. Any further queries, happy to help again.
